BY Palaitha Ariyawansa and Aneesha Manage
Work in all hospitals countrywide came to a standstill yesterday due to a strike undertaken by the minor employees.
The Joint Health Services Union had organised the protest against an alleged irregularity in recruiting minor employees and regarding several other demands. Admission of patients and functioning of the clinics had been crippled. However the Army was called to attend to the duties of the strikers in several hospitals while the trade union had made arrangements to attend to the emergency duties.
